The debut album from fiery vocalist Lyn Collins, produced by James Brown, contained her biggest hit ‘Think (About It)’, which has been sampled on literally 1000s of hip hop, house, hardcore, jungle and drum and bass records. The album is a mix of mid-tempo R’n’B and funky numbers, all delivered in that unmistakable powerhouse voice, along with a couple of ballads where Collins really gets a chance to shine. Although it’s the JBs supplying the music, with plenty of church organ, upfront brass and Collins’ gospel-influenced singing style, there’s something of a southern soul feel to much of the album.
